The Ivy on the Square Edinburgh  |  https://theivyedinburgh.com/ 

6 St. Andrew Square, Edinburgh, EH2 2BD

Opening Hours: Monday – Sunday 15:00~17:00

            

At The Ivy you have a selection of afternoon teas to choose from which you can enjoy in a beautiful setting. You can opt for “CREAM TEA” for £7.95 with freshly baked fruit scones, Dorset clotted cream and strawberry preserve. It includes a choice of teas, infusions or coffees. For the price, this little afternoon tea offer with a cup of tea and three scones is a total bargain and absolutely delicious. They offer “SUMMER GARDEN AFTERNOON TEA” for £24.95, with a choice of savoury or sweet. My top recommendation is the “CHAMPAGNE AFTERNOON TEA” for £33.95 where you can enjoy a lovely glass of champagne with your afternoon tea, and includes a choice of teas, infusions or coffees.

 

The Dome  |  https://www.thedomeedinburgh.com/georgiantearoom 

14 George Street, Edinburgh, EH2 2PF

Opening Hours: Served daily from noon to 17:00

             

You can enjoy a lovely afternoon tea at the Dome on the 1st floor in the splendid surroundings of The Georgian Tea Room. The room can be accessed via their staircase and lift. They offer a standard Afternoon Tea, a NGCI Afternoon Tea, a Vegan Afternoon Tea, and a Children’s Afternoon Tea. In the standard Afternoon Tea, you can enjoy lovely sandwiches, a savoury dish, some plain and fruit scones served with clotted cream and jam, the chef’s selection of cakes and macaroons, and a choice of loose leaf teas or a pot of house blend coffee, all for £22 per person. You can add a glass of champagne chimère for £29 per person or a glass of cava for £27 per person. Highly recommend The Dome for a filling afternoon tea in a comfortable setting. I would especially recommend paying a visit during Christmas time as the decorations are just splendid and add to the gorgeous building.

 

The Witchery by the Castle | https://www.thewitchery.com/afternoon-tea 

Opening hours: Monday – Friday 15:00~16:00

352 Castlehill, Edinburgh EH1 2NF

             

At The Witchery by the Castle, you get to indulge in a beautiful afternoon tea spread surrounded by a gorgeous and traditional Scottish setting. Marvellous sandwiches and delicious cakes piled high on silver cake stands. Their sandwiches are like no other, offering an Edinburgh Gin cured salmon with dill creme fraiche filling on rye bread and a brioche bun with egg and cress. They also serve a selection of delightful sweet treats including freshly baked scones, dragon cake and rich chocolate tarts. The afternoon tea is served with your choice of specially selected loose leaf tea which are all so tasty. You can enjoy the standard afternoon tea for £35 per person, add a glass of Billecart-Salmon Champagne for £47 per person, and £55 per person with a glass of Billecart-Salmon Rosé Champagne.

 

Prestonfield House  |  https://www.prestonfield.com/dine/afternoon-tea 

Prestonfield House, Priestfield Road, Edinburgh, EH16 5UT

Opening Hours: Served daily from 12pm~18:00

               

         

If you’re looking for a memorable tea out, Prestonfield House is the place for you. Served by the side of a roaring log fire throughout the winter, and in the rose-filled gardens or the whimsical gothic tea house throughout the summer. They offer an afternoon tea menu, a vegan afternoon tea menu, and a vegetarian afternoon tea menu. Enjoy a mouth-watering selection of leaf teas including Prestonfield’s own unique blends, their outstanding home baking, hot savouries, scones with their own raspberry jam and traditional sandwiches all in an extraordinary surrounding. You can indulge in a Traditional Afternoon Tea for £35 per person or opt for a Champagne Afternoon Tea with a glass of Billecart-Salmon Champagne for £45 per person.

 

Café Portrait   |   https://www.heritageportfolio.co.uk/vouchers/cafe-vouchers/ 

Café Portrait, 1 Queen Street, Edinburgh, EH2 1JD

Opening Hours: Afternoon Tea is served daily from 14:30~16:30 in the Snug

                

At £40 for 2 people, you can enjoy a tiered stand laden with delicious savouries, fantastic scones, and other irresistible home-baking, all in the stunning surroundings of the Scottish National Portrait Gallery. A request for half the food to be vegetarian friendly is accommodated too which is a lovely touch. The portion size is huge, so you’ll never be dissatisfied with the amount you get to eat. Great service with tea refills even though the pots are big enough that you might not even need it. Great value and the portrait gallery you can visit afterwards makes it all the more enjoyable.

 

Harvey Nichols  |  https://www.harveynichols.com/news/2020/08/19/afternoon-tea-edinburgh/ 

30, 34 St Andrew Square, Edinburgh, EH2 2AD

Opening Hours: Sunday – Saturday 14:00~16:00

                  

Wanting to celebrate in style with a lovely afternoon tea menu and spectacular views over the Edinburgh City skyline? Then Harvey Nichols is definitely the place for you. Indulge in classic favourites from hot smoked salmon, served with creamy potato salad to scones with clotted cream and preserves. Finish on a sweet note with summer berry tart, peanut butter pie and chocolate brownie. They take reservations only so do keep in mind to book a spot before paying a visit. Afternoon Tea is served for £22 per person, £30 per person with a glass of champagne and £32 per person for a Rosé champagne afternoon tea. Highly recommend paying Harvey Nichols a visit to enjoy a fantastic afternoon tea with an unforgettable view.

 

Tigerlily  |  https://www.tigerlilyedinburgh.co.uk/offers/bar-restaurant-offers/afternoon-tea/ 

125 George St, Edinburgh EH2 4JN

Opening Hours: Available every day from 14:00~17:00

                            

You are assured a wonderful afternoon tea menu at Tigerlily with a selection of yummy savouries, delicious homemade fruit scones, marvelous chocolate treats and more. You can delight in a variety of delicacies for a mere £17.50 per person. The standard afternoon tea option includes an array of sandwiches including honey roast ham, Arran mustard & tomato on wholemeal bread, and smoked Scottish salmon, cucumber & cream cheese on white bread. To add to the extensive list, it also includes a lovely caramelised red onion and goats cheese quiche, lemon meringue tart, salt caramel éclair, carrot cake with cream cheese icing, and much more. You can opt for the Deluxe Tea with a glass of Cloudy Bay Sparkling Wine for £22.50 per person, or the Cocktail Tea for £25 per person in which you have a choice of different cocktails to enjoy alongside your afternoon tea, or a Champagne Tea for £34 per person with a glass of Veuve Clicquot Rosé.

 

Waldorf Astoria Edinburgh – The Caledonian   https://waldorfastoria3.hilton.com/en/hotels/united-kingdom/waldorf-astoria-edinburgh-the-caledonian-EDNCHWA/amenities/restaurants-peacock-alley.html 

Princes St, Edinburgh EH1 2AB

Opening Hours: Traditional Afternoon Tea,  Monday – Sunday 12pm~17:00

Savoury Afternoon Tea,  Monday – Sunday 15:00~18:00

                           

       

In such a charming and historic building, the afternoon tea is like no other. They have offered different themed afternoon teas in the past including one inspired by Edinburgh Zoo, and another by Harry Potter. Rest assured you will have the most wonderful and traditional afternoon tea, served daily in such a beautiful and iconic space, featuring unique pastries, homemade scones and exquisite sandwiches for £35 per person. You could also splurge on something fancier and opt for the Champagne Afternoon Tea for £45 per person. It’s definitely a generous afternoon tea that will keep you full and satisfied, and all so beautifully presented. The teas themselves were lovely as well, with lots of options to choose from, some of them quite unique and delicious. The atmosphere is fantastic too, classy and relaxed, with nice background piano music. Cannot recommend the afternoon tea at the Waldorf Astoria enough!
